Elisa's DAS Subsea Cable Protection System Nears Operational Deployment
Finnish operator Elisa has completed testing of subsea cable monitoring technology using Distributed Acoustic Sensing (DAS), conducted with the Finnish navy and border guard. The system is now being built into an automated service that can alert authorities and infrastructure owners in case of exceptional situations [citation:??].

Statkraft Reservoir Monitoring Pilot Uses Fibre Optic Cables
Cautus Geo delivered and installed over two kilometres of fibre cables to Statkraft's new facility at Haukeli in January 2026, supporting a pilot project for monitoring and securing water reservoirs . Application Context: While specific details of the monitoring technology remain limited, the installation highlights the expanding application of fibre optic sensing for hydrological monitoring beyond marine environments, extending to freshwater reservoir management and dam safety applications . This represents a growing trend: using distributed fiber optic sensing (DFOS) for infrastructure monitoring in inland water systems, complementing the more widely publicized subsea cable applications.
